What is a part time non clinical RN?

A Part Time Non Clinical RN is a registered nurse who works part time in roles that do not involve direct patient care. Instead of bedside nursing, these positions may include responsibilities such as case management, telephone triage, health education, quality assurance, research, or administrative duties. Non-clinical RNs use their nursing knowledge in support roles to improve patient outcomes, develop policies, or provide healthcare guidance. These positions are ideal for nurses seeking flexibility and alternative ways to utilize their expertise outside of traditional patient care settings.

What are the typical responsibilities of a part time non clinical RN and how do these differ from traditional bedside nursing roles?

Part Time Non Clinical RNs often focus on roles such as case management, patient education, quality improvement, telephone triage, or administrative support rather than direct patient care. Their daily tasks may include reviewing patient records, coordinating care plans, providing health coaching, or ensuring compliance with healthcare regulations. Collaboration with multidisciplinary teams and strong communication skills are essential, as the role often involves working with physicians, social workers, and administrative staff. Compared to bedside nursing, these positions usually offer more predictable hours and less physical demand, which can be appealing to those seeking work-life balance.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time non clinical RN,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time Non Clinical RN, you need an active RN license, strong clinical knowledge, and often experience in healthcare education, case management, or quality assurance. Familiarity with electronic health records (EHRs), care coordination platforms, and compliance or auditing systems is typically required. Exceptional communication, organizational skills, and attention to detail set candidates apart in these roles. These abilities are vital for ensuring regulatory compliance, effective patient education, and seamless coordination across healthcare teams without direct bedside care.

What is the difference between Part Time Non Clinical Rn vs Part Time Clinical Nurse?

AspectPart Time Non Clinical RnPart Time Clinical Nurse
CertificationsRegistered Nurse (RN) licenseRegistered Nurse (RN) license
Work EnvironmentAdministrative, educational, or telehealth settingsHospitals, clinics, patient care units
Job DutiesCare coordination, case management, health educationDirect patient care, assessments, treatments
Industry UsageHealthcare, insurance, telehealthHospitals, clinics, outpatient facilities

Part Time Non Clinical Rns typically work in administrative or educational roles within healthcare, focusing on patient management and health promotion without direct bedside care. In contrast, Part Time Clinical Nurses provide direct patient care in clinical settings. Both roles require an RN license but differ significantly in work environment and responsibilities.
